Just a FYI that the WPL has started as of yesterday, right now we have 32 boats that are taking part. Still room for anyone that would like to join in.

Requirments are few. There is a small d/l that allows everyone to play the same map. The D/L also backs up your default files. Right now we are only playing with 1.4b patch and SH3 commander. Everyone plays the campaign and once a convoy is sighted the contact sub informs BDU via forums. A multiplayer game is made a wolfpack is formed with subs within range,and sent to commanding sub and it is played online.

Couple of tid bits you may find intriging as far as the campaign that WPL is playing with:
1. Over 160 convoys are in the campaign from Sept 1st 1939 to the end of 1940.
2. Aircraft are all scripped to "elite", even early in the war.
3. Later in the war there are bombing raids on the subpens, During our startup meeting Hornet said once you start always look up. :o
4. Realism settings are done fairly you can play at 100% for the expert player down to around 60% or so for the new player out there. About 4-5 settings are "optional" all others are checked.
